The Core Principles of Budget Management

Before diving into specific betting patterns, it is essential to establish a "bankroll." This is a fixed amount of money set aside specifically for lottery play that does not interfere with your daily living expenses. For a low-budget approach, the goal is to minimize the cost per draw while maximizing the coverage of numbers.

  • Set a Weekly Limit: Decide on a small, sustainable amount to spend per week and stick to it regardless of the outcome.
  • Avoid the "Chase": Never increase your bet size to recover a previous loss; this is the fastest way to deplete a small budget.
  • Track Your Spending: Keep a simple log of your bets and wins to understand your actual hit rate over time.

Common Pitfalls to Avoid

Many beginners fall into traps that make low-budget play impossible. To maintain a consistent presence in the game, avoid these common mistakes:

  • Buying "Sure-Win" Tips: Be wary of individuals selling "guaranteed" winning numbers. No one can predict a random draw, and paying for tips is a waste of your limited budget.
  • Over-betting on Special Draws: While special or bonus draws are tempting, they often lead to impulsive spending. Treat them as an occasional treat rather than a core part of your strategy.
  • Ignoring Probability: Remember that every single number combination has the same mathematical chance of being drawn. Don't waste money on "pretty" patterns (like 1234) if you believe they are more likely to hit; they are not.
